Former Senior Mountie Kevin Brosseau Appointed As Canada's Fentanyl Czar | CBC News
Politics The federal government appointed former Mountie Kevin Brosseau as Canada’s new “fentanyl czar” on Tuesday — a role created in part to soothe U.S. President Donald Trump’s concerns about the northern border and pause a developing trade war.
